Features Sailing World's Boat of The Year 1987. This boat has always sailed on freshwater in the great lakes, and stored indoors(for the past 17 years) or under shrink wrap with the mast down. Very light use and significant upgrades since 2000. Also features a custom welded storage cradle.

Accommodations Boat has beautiful joinery work below. Looks a lot like a J-35C below in fit and finish. Has a traditional layout with head forward, set down Nav. Station, and fold up table on bulk head.
One stateroom sleeps 2, dinette sleeps 1, settee sleeps 1 and quarter berth sleeps 2 to accommodate a total of 6 owners and guests.
